Low self-esteem hurts: it reduces happiness, takes away motivation, and causes problematic symptoms such as panic attacks, worry, loneliness, and poor performance in many areas of life. It may seem impossible now, but you can get self esteem and learn to like yourself.
The fact that you are reading about self esteem right now shows that you are interested in finding some ways to feel better about yourself. This motivation will help you find the skills and tools you need to improve your self esteem, find purpose, and move forward with the self-confidence to succeed in life.
Perhaps you already have a solid sense of self-worth and self-confidence, and you are here because you hope to improve self-esteem even further to optimize your success in work, relationships, and life overall. If so, you may find the exercises on personal growth and life purpose especially relevant.
Maybe you have extremely low self esteem and suffer from low self confidence and general unhappiness. You may even have experienced peer pressure and bullying, or suffer from panic attacks, eating disorders, addiction, on other conditions that may be related to low self esteem. You may benefit from the exercises on social anxiety, self talk, affirmations, body image, and changing negative thinking.
Whether you have high self esteem, no self esteem, or are somewhere in between, you can get self esteem (or get more self-esteem) with some hard work and effort.
